Candidate Profile: Key accountabilities, skills & experience

Purpose of the role:

The Civil Engineering team in London provide engineering services on projects within London and Internationally, ranging from high quality public realm supporting office developments to large scale infrastructure projects and city-wide masterplans. Within this temporary role you will contribute to the design and preparation of deliverables associated with a number of our current projects.

What you'll do:

  • Preparing technical deliverables for civil engineering projects including drawings, models, presentations as well as short written reports.
  • Supporting the delivery of projects which may including attending client meetings, producing bid documents and general business development activities.
  • Contributing to a culture of technical excellence and the development of technical skills within the wider team through planning and delivery of initiatives and training.
  • Embracing our Culture, Equity and Inclusion strategy and vision, both through your own behaviour and influencing others.

The skills you'll need:

  • Strong capability in Autodesk AutoCAD and/or Civil 3D as an essential pre-requisite. Desirable experience of other relevant design tools which may include Revit, Navisworks, Bentley 3D AECOsim, Microdrainage and GIS.
  • Technical experience in one or more areas relevant to civil engineering (earthworks, roads and streets, public realm, utilities, flood risk and drainage).
  • Excellent communication skills, and an ability to interact collaboratively with colleagues and other members of professional teams with confidence.
  • An ability to manage a complex and varied workload often involving multiple concurrent projects.
